What changed here
DerivedBharatiya Janata Party held the seat; the winning margin widened from 6.7% to 9.0%.
Boundaries were redrawn between 2003 and 2008 — the comparison is matched by name and is indicative only.
- Vote consolidatedThe top two candidates took 94.2% of the vote between them, up from 81.5% — a tighter two-way contest.
